Why the Suzuki Ignis Remains Popular
The Suzuki Ignis has carved a niche as an affordable, surprisingly capable compact crossover. Its blend of practicality, fuel efficiency, and modern tech appeals to many drivers. The SZ-T trim adds even more convenience with features designed for everyday use.
Originally launched in 2017, the Ignis received updates, including the Dualjet engine, enhancing performance and economy. This particular 2021 model represents a sweet spot—recent enough to have modern amenities but still readily available at attractive prices.

Understanding the Features
Beyond the listed features, this Suzuki Ignis SZ-T includes a range of standard equipment. Electric door mirrors and front windows offer added convenience while climate control ensures comfortable journeys. DAB Radio provides high quality audio reception.
The touchscreen system offers intuitive access to vehicle settings and entertainment options. A USB port allows for charging devices on the move, alongside the 12V socket. The height-adjustable driver’s seat improves comfort for longer trips
